Legal DNA Test in India

Posted by DNA Forensics Laboratory on June 5th, 2021

Legal matters can be a real botheration. In such cases, a Legal DNA Test may come in handy. This DNA Test is used for court matters or presented as court-admissible evidence to prove biological relationships. Some of these include:

  • Maternity and Paternity issues

  • Property disputes

  • Will disputes

  • Child-custody or child support issues

  • Marital disputes 

  • Organ transplantation 

  • Immigration applications

  • Forensic investigations of murder, rape, and other crimes 

  • Signature and document verification in forgery cases

  • Name change on birth certificates 

 

Commonly used Legal DNA tests are:

  • Legal DNA Test for Paternity: The test strengthens a father-child relationship by establishing their biological relationship. A child inherits part of DNA from his/her father – this DNA test compares this genetic material of the test participants.  

  • Legal DNA Test for Maternity: Every child inherits mtDNA from its mother. The mtDNA (mitochondrial DNA) forms the basis of the maternity test. The test establishes the pious relationship between a child and the mother.

  • Legal Paternity Trio DNA Test: It is a paternity test that involves the participation of the child’s mother. It requires samples from the child, alleged mother, and alleged father. The mother's involvement gives better accuracy and reliability to this test compared to the “motherless” paternity test. 

  • Legal DNA Test for Siblingship: The test identifies the biological relationship between two alleged siblings. The siblings could be full siblings, identical twins, half-siblings, or unrelated. 

  • Court Admissible DNA Test for Organ Transplant: Organ transplantation surgery from a donor to recipient needs a preliminary DNA test to ensure if the participants are compatible for a transplant. 

  • Court Admissible DNA Test for Immigration: In many cases, the DNA test done for immigration purposes should be admissible as evidence by courts. The petitioner and beneficiary can opt for any test configuration, including maternity test, paternity test, grand-parentage test, sibling-ship test, etc.

The required sample collection of a Legal DNA Test is done following a standard protocol in the presence of a judge or a government-appointed representative, also referred to as a ‘chain of custody’.
